Board hears DLA assessment for Central Middle School; asks for $55 million focused option

Evergreen Park ESD 124 Board of Education · January 22, 2026

DLA Architects told the Evergreen Park ESD 124 board that near-term mechanical and life-safety work at Central Middle School could total roughly $4.9 million plus $500,000 O&M contingency; trustees asked the firm to return with a focused, lower-cost design and requested a $55 million targeted option rather than a previously discussed $74.9 million districtwide package.

DLA Architects presented a facility assessment of Central Middle School on Jan. 21, outlining a set of near-term mechanical, plumbing and life-safety needs and preliminary cost estimates. The firm identified unit-vent replacements last performed in 1996 and original boilers dating from the 1970s as items approaching the end of their service life. Ed Wright of DLA told trustees the near-term package the firm reviewed is about $4.9 million with an additional roughly $500,000 for operations and maintenance contingency — for a total near-term estimate of about $5.5 million.…
